活动介绍
file-type

如何在LabVIEW中导入Excel数据至表格

下载需积分: 9 | 24KB | 更新于2025-03-22 | 112 浏览量 | 16 下载量 举报 收藏
download 立即下载
在详细解释如何将数据从Excel导入到LabVIEW中的过程中,首先需要了解LabVIEW和Excel两个应用程序的基本工作原理和它们之间的关系。接下来,我们将深入探讨LabVIEW中用于数据导入的VI(Virtual Instrument,虚拟仪器)文件及其功能。 ### LabVIEW简介 LabVIEW是由National Instruments(NI)开发的一款图形化编程语言,广泛应用于数据采集、仪器控制以及工业自动化等领域。LabVIEW使用数据流编程方法,其程序被称为VI,包含前面板(Front Panel)和块图(Block Diagram)两个部分。前面板类似于物理仪器的面板,包含各种控件和指示器,用于用户交互;块图则用于实现程序的逻辑。 ### Excel简介 Excel是微软公司开发的一款电子表格程序,用于数据存储、数据分析和报表制作。Excel文件通常以`.xlsx`或`.xls`为扩展名,包含多个工作表(Sheet),每个工作表由单元格(Cell)组成,每个单元格可以包含文本、数字、公式等信息。 ### 将Excel数据导入LabVIEW 在LabVIEW中导入Excel数据需要使用LabVIEW的Excel读取函数。这通常涉及以下步骤: 1. **打开Excel文件**:使用LabVIEW的`Open/Close File.vi`函数或其他相关的文件操作VI来打开Excel文件。 2. **读取数据**:一旦文件被打开,就可以使用一系列的VI来读取数据,例如`Read From Spreadsheet File.vi`可以用于读取特定格式的电子表格文件。对于`.xlsx`文件,可能需要使用`Read From Workbook.vi`。 3. **定位数据位置**:为了将数据导入特定页面、行和列,可以使用VI来定位并获取对应的数据。例如,`Read From Spreadsheet File.vi`允许用户指定行和列的起始位置以及读取的行数和列数。 4. **数据类型转换**:从Excel读取的数据可能是字符串格式,根据需要导入到LabVIEW中的数据类型,可能需要进行数据类型转换。LabVIEW提供了多种数据类型转换函数,如`To Numeric String.vi`和`String to Number.vi`等。 5. **更新LabVIEW表格**:获取到的数据需要放置到LabVIEW的数组、图表或表格中。可以使用`Build Array.vi`等函数构建数据数组,然后使用`Write to Measurement File.vi`或将其直接放置到控件中。 ### 实际操作 文件名`Insert data into labview.vi`暗示了该VI的主要功能是数据导入。具体操作步骤可能如下: - 打开`Insert data into labview.vi`,在块图中找到相关函数和结构。 - 查找文件操作VI,确定如何打开和读取Excel文件。 - 观察是否配置了读取数据的起始位置、行数和列数,确保数据可被准确地导入到LabVIEW表格中。 - 根据需要查看是否进行了数据类型转换,特别是从Excel的字符串到LabVIEW期望的数据类型的转换。 - 最后,观察数据被导入到LabVIEW中的方式,比如是直接显示在前面板的控件上,还是存储在数组中供后续处理。 ### 注意事项 - 在进行数据导入之前,要确保Excel文件没有被其他应用程序锁定或正在使用。 - 导入的数据量不宜过大,以免造成LabVIEW程序运行缓慢或出现错误。 - 当处理特殊数据格式或公式时,可能需要对Excel文件进行预处理,确保数据能够正确导入到LabVIEW中。 通过上述步骤,可以将Excel中的数据准确导入到LabVIEW表格中。这不仅增强了LabVIEW的数据处理能力,还提供了更多数据交互的可能性,使得LabVIEW能够更好地服务于自动化控制、数据分析等场景。

相关推荐